  1. I see, but that’s not a full-screen slider. It’s just a auto responsive slider, please check the other thread you open. I replied with the instruction on how to apply it directly to the template.

  2. Unfortunately, 3 columns is not really possible with page layout. You can only achieve with the 3rd column through the builder, but again, it may have different width since it’s based on percentage of current container. The site you have provided has the same layout which is content left and sidebar right, but he applied 2 columns within the content making it looks like 3 columns

  1. Just like #2, he has content left and sidebar right, then just created 2 columns within the content area. Please do that as well within the builder.

That site isn’t made from cornerstone, it appears to be all custom.
